Toronto: Macmillan, 1965. First Edition. Hardcover. Very good/Very good. 190 p. 21 cm. B&w line drawings by Bice. Blue cloth in mylar-covered pictorial dustjacket. Jacket has some soiling and front flap's corners clipped. Light shelf wear to book. Some spotting to endpapers and text block edge. Signed by Bice on title page.
